SLDN Disappointed by President-Elect Obama's Selection of Reverend Rick Warren for Inaugural Invocation
WASHINGTON, D.C. - Today Servicemembers Legal Defense Network (SLDN) issued the following statement regarding the selection of Reverend Rick Warren to deliver the invocation at President-elect Barack Obama's 56th Presidential Inauguration on January 20.
"We are disappointed by President-elect Obama's selection of the Reverend Rick Warren to deliver his invocation and urge him to reconsider this decision," said Aubrey Sarvis, executive director of the Servicemembers Legal Defense Network. "Rev. Warren's divisive attacks on equality for the gay, lesbian, bisexual and transgender community should not be rewarded at this historic time of change and inclusion that Obama's swearing in marks for our nation."
Servicemembers Legal Defense Network is a national, non-profit legal services, watchdog and policy organization dedicated to ending discrimination against and harassment of military personnel affected by "Don't Ask, Don't Tell" and related forms of intolerance.
